Output 1426fa4e122dd56c3fe4e84cf81e6f8a7090c4593600a821eda96becc8d74a87:0

value
818415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95eceea2c54639ed04ea7319c832de609dfad907 OP_EQUALVERIFY OP_CHECKSIG
address
1EfjWvH91eqCxVhJyNmjuvCSS1dqFDw11Q
transaction
1426fa4e122dd56c3fe4e84cf81e6f8a7090c4593600a821eda96becc8d74a87
confirmations
351765
spent
true